Fugitive serial killer gunned down in Chongqing

CHINA'S most wanted fugitive Zhou Kehua exchanged gunshots with police before he was shot dead this morning in Chongqing Municipality in southwest China, police told the state-run CCTV.

The 42-year-old serial killer who murdered nine people and injured five others in the past eight years was spotted at 6:45am in the Tongjiaqiao area in the city's Shapingba District and two officers followed him into a lane.

Zhou suddenly turned around and fired three shots at the two plainclothed officers. One officer hid himself behind a pole, another clung to a wall. They shot Zhou dead with four bullets, CCTV said.

Police found two pistols at Zhou's side, 300 yuan (US$47.16) in cash and some tickets in his pocket.

Chonqqing police said they found the trail of Zhou in a downtown shopping center on August 11, one day after he killed one woman and injured two men in an armed robbery outside a local bank office.

But he did not escape into the Gele Mountain where he was believed hiding. To confuse him, police and troops were still sent to the mountain in a large-scale manhunt while special squads closed in on him in downtown, CCTV said.

Zhou's body has been taken away and many police are guarding the scene.
